QUOTE(iwubpreve @ Oct 18 2014, 01:38 AM) how many square feet? built up area of the shop. u can use abt RM175 per square feet to calculate. built up area, not land area. say 5 storey is 5000 build up area, then is 175 x 5000 equal to 875k. thus us just general guild line. approval from authority u need get runner to do for u. competent 1 can help u expedite the approval quickly, but u need to pay for it at higher cost. usually is Malay. oh built up area will be around 45 X80 (reserving some place for side and back) if 3 floors + 1 parking facility underneath 45 X80= 3600 3600 X (3+1) = 144000 st built up total so 144000 x RM175= 2.52 million? RM175, inclusive of building structure till finish? is it possible to do piling for 3-4 storey first, but built 2 storey and 1 parking facility, then upgrade sumore?

QUOTE(iwubpreve @ Oct 18 2014, 09:25 AM) yes, including. but then again the correct way of doing it is set the budget first. say u consider RM175 then overall building cost is 2.52million. then from there u start to monitor. if budget likely to burst, consider do reduce some type of material. yes, u can do foundation for 3-4 storey and then just build 2 storey and upgrade in the future. but have to consider a lot of factor. when u upgrade in future, the cost would be higher because a lot of temporary work. and somemore, when u upgrading, the house have to be vacant and is not habitable. thank you very verymuch.. btw do we need any architect to raft the plan before building?
